加截中...

PWA开发指南:打造下一代渐进式网页应用的核心策略

在移动优先的今天,用户体验已成为网站建设成败的关键。渐进式网页应用(PWA)正是这一趋势下的革命性技术,它将网页的便捷与原生应用的优质体验完美结合。

什么是PWA?

PWA并非一个特定的框架,而是一套理念和技术的集合。它通过现代Web技术,让网站能够像原生应用一样被安装到设备主屏幕,并提供离线工作、消息推送等丰富功能。其核心在于“渐进式”——无论用户使用何种浏览器或设备,都能获得基础且可用的体验,并在支持的环境中逐步增强至最佳状态。

PWA是一套理念和技术的集合

PWA的核心技术优势

PWA的成功建立在三大技术支柱之上:

  1. 可靠性:Service Worker
    这是一个在浏览器后台运行的脚本,充当网络代理。它能够缓存关键资源,即使在网络不稳定或完全离线的情况下,用户也能瞬间加载页面核心内容,彻底告别“恐龙游戏”页面。

  2. 体验感:Web App Manifest
    这是一个JSON文件,它让开发者能够控制应用如何呈现给用户。通过它,您可以定义应用的名称、启动图标、主题颜色和显示模式(全屏),使其在安装后与原生应用几乎无异。

  3. 吸引力:推送通知与安装提示
    PWA可以像原生应用一样向用户推送有价值的通知,有效促进用户回流。同时,当满足一定条件时,浏览器会主动提示用户“添加到主屏幕”,极大地降低了应用的获取门槛。

PWA的成功建立在三大技术支柱之上

如何将您的网站改造为PWA

将现有网站升级为PWA并非难事,主要包含四个步骤:

  • 第一步:实现HTTPS。这是PWA的安全基础,也是Service Worker工作的先决条件。

  • 第二步:创建并注册Service Worker。设计合理的缓存策略,预先缓存静态资源(如CSS、JS、图片),并动态缓存API数据。

  • 第三步:编写Web App Manifest文件。配置好应用的元数据,并在HTML头部通过``链接。

  • 第四步:确保响应式设计。PWA必须能在所有尺寸的屏幕上提供出色的浏览体验。

PWA可以像原生应用一样向用户推送有价值的通知

结语

拥抱PWA意味着为您的用户提供更快、更稳定、更具吸引力的网络体验。它不仅是技术上的升级,更是网站建设思维的战略性转变。通过实施这份指南,您将能构建出真正面向未来的现代化网站,在激烈的竞争中脱颖而出。

在线客服
服务热线

服务热线

13648088499

微信咨询
二维码
返回顶部